0

현재 Java v2.9 용 Facebook Ads SDK를 사용 중이며 v2.10 또는 v2.11로 업그레이드하려고합니다. 그러나 최신 버전 모두 AdInsights 객체에 getFieldImpressionDevice 메서드가 있습니까? 이 호출과 관련된 변경 또는 비추천에 대해 설명하는 변경 로그 정보를 찾지 못했습니다. 누구나이 문제에 대해 통찰력을 갖고 있습니까? . github에이 이유에 또한Facebook SDK 2.0 용 Java SDK AdsInsights.getFieldImpressionDevice() 메소드가 없습니다.

조금 혼란 :이 링크는, 그것을 나타내는 경우에도 예를 들어

https://github.com/facebook/facebook-java-ads-sdk/

는 2.10 또는 2.11 libs와에게 단지 2.9 libs와이없는,

SRC/주/자바/COM/페이스 북/광고 광고 SDK V2.11 출시 년 11 월 8 도움

답변

0

에 대한 2017

덕분에 알려진있다 문제가 나온다. AdsInsights 클래스의 분석 필드 및 메소드 중 일부 (또는 전체)가 삭제되었습니다. 예를 들어, raw json을 사용하여 작업 할 수 있습니다. 예 :

JsonObject jo = insight.getRawResponseAsJsonObject(); 
JsonElement je = jo.get("impression_device"); 
String device = je.getAsString();